#Copy the current function as a Binana symbol entry to your clipboard # @runtime Jython # @category Binana # @author Thunderbrew # @keybinding Shift-F # @menupath # @toolbar logo.png from ghidra.program.model.symbol import SymbolType from java.awt import Toolkit from java.awt.datatransfer import StringSelection from ghidra.app.decompiler import DecompInterface from ghidra.util.task import ConsoleTaskMonitor def yank_to_clipboard(text): selection = StringSelection(text) clipboard = Toolkit.getDefaultToolkit().getSystemClipboard() clipboard.setContents(selection, None) def get_high_function_signature(func): """Uses the Decompiler to get the refined signature.""" if func is None: return "" iface = DecompInterface() iface.openProgram(currentProgram) results = iface.decompileFunction(func, 30, ConsoleTaskMonitor()) high_func = results.getHighFunction() if high_func is None: return ret_type = high_func.getFunctionPrototype().getReturnType().getName().replace(" *", "*") call_conv = high_func.getFunctionPrototype().getModelName() params = [] num_params = high_func.getFunctionPrototype().getNumParams() for i in range(num_params): p = high_func.getFunctionPrototype().getParam(i) params.append("{} {}".format(p.getDataType().getName().replace(" *", "*"), p.getName())) param_str = "(" + (", ".join(params)) + ")" return ret_type + " " + call_conv + " func" + param_str def get_symbol_entry_for_function(func): name = func.getName() entry_addr = func.getEntryPoint().toString().upper()[-8:] body = func.getBody() end_addr = (body.getMaxAddress().add(1)).toString().upper()[-8:] full_signature = get_high_function_signature(func) output = "{} {} f end={} type=\"{}\"".format( name, entry_addr, end_addr, full_signature ) return output def yank_current_function_symbol(): listing = currentProgram.getListing() func = listing.getFunctionContaining(currentAddress) if func is None: print("No function found at the current cursor position.") return output = get_symbol_entry_for_function(func) yank_to_clipboard(output) print("Copied to clipboard: {}".format(output)) yank_current_function_symbol()
